1. What Are Sino-foreign Cooperative Universities? | 什么是中外合作办学大学?

Sino-foreign cooperative universities are independent legal entities jointly established by Chinese and foreign higher education institutions. They offer full-time undergraduate and postgraduate programmes, with instruction primarily in English. Notable examples include the University of Nottingham Ningbo China, Xi’an Jiaotong-Liverpool University, New York University Shanghai, Duke Kunshan University, Wenzhou-Kean University, Shenzhen MSU-BIT University, Guangdong Technion – Israel Institute of Technology, and BNU-HKBU United International College. Graduates typically receive degrees from both the Chinese and the partner foreign university, which are recognised internationally.

2. Main Application Pathways | 主要申请途径

There are two primary routes to enter these universities. The first is the Gaokao unified admission route, where you apply through the national college application system using your Gaokao score. This is similar to applying to any Chinese state university. The second is the comprehensive evaluation admission, also known as independent recruitment or “Self-Enrolment.” This pathway evaluates applicants holistically, combining Gaokao scores, school assessments, and high school academic proficiency test results. Some universities, such as NYU Shanghai and Duke Kunshan University, rely exclusively on the comprehensive evaluation route, while others like Xi’an Jiaotong-Liverpool offer both pathways.

3. Gaokao Score Requirements | 高考成绩要求

For the comprehensive evaluation pathway, a minimum Gaokao score equivalent to the provincial Tier 1 cutoff line (special type enrollment line) is almost always required. Competitive programmes often demand scores well above this threshold. For instance, NYU Shanghai typically expects applicants to exceed the special type line significantly, and the final admission decision combines this with the Campus Day performance. Duke Kunshan University assigns ranks such as “Pre-admission A” (guaranteed admission upon reaching the special type line) and “Pre-admission B” (selected based on overall ranking). For Gaokao-only admission, the required scores vary by province and major, but generally fall within the top-tier bracket of local universities.

4. English Language Proficiency Requirements | 英语语言能力要求

Because instruction is almost entirely in English, strong English proficiency is critical. In addition to a high Gaokao English score, many comprehensive evaluation programmes request standardised English test results. The following table shows typical minimum requirements for direct submission (where required):

由于教学几乎全英文进行,出色的英语能力至关重要。除了高考英语高分外,许多综合评价招生项目要求提交标准化英语考试成绩。下表列出部分院校直接提交时的常见最低要求:

Test / 考试 Minimum Score / 最低分数
IELTS / 雅思 6.5 – 7.0
TOEFL iBT / 托福网考 90 – 100
Duolingo / 多邻国 115 – 125

If you do not have these scores, a strong Gaokao English result (usually above 120 out of 150) may be accepted by some universities, but competitive applicants often provide additional evidence. English interview performance during Campus Day also heavily influences the evaluation.

5. Application Materials Checklist | 申请材料清单

A complete application package usually includes: a filled online application form, high school transcripts, results of the High School Academic Proficiency Test (Hui Kao), a personal statement (in English), one or two recommendation letters from class teachers or subject instructors, standardised English test scores (if available), copies of awards or competition certificates, and a passport or ID copy. Some universities, like NYU Shanghai, require additional short essays or a video introduction. Always check the specific university’s requirements on its official website.

6. Comprehensive Evaluation Admission Process | 综合评价录取流程

The comprehensive evaluation route typically follows these steps: online application submission during the first semester of senior year, initial screening of materials, notification of qualified candidates, Campus Day (or interview day) activities, announcement of pre-admission status, and final admission after Gaokao results are released. The evaluation weighting varies; for example, Duke Kunshan uses a “541” model (Gaokao 50%, school assessment 40%, Hui Kao 10%), while other institutions may adopt different ratios. NYU Shanghai provides two pre-admission tiers: ‘A’ (automatic admission upon meeting the special type line) and ‘B’ (competitive selection).

7. Key Timeline: First Semester of Senior Year (Sep – Jan) | 重要时间节点:高三上学期(9月–1月)

September – October: Research target universities thoroughly, understand their deadlines, and begin drafting your personal statement and updating your CV. November – December: Most application portals open. NYU Shanghai ‘s early deadline usually falls in early January, and Duke Kunshan ‘s by early February. Prepare recommendation letters, scan transcripts, and gather all supporting documents. By the end of January, submit your applications, pay the fee, and ensure all materials are uploaded or dispatched. This period is also ideal for taking the Duolingo English Test or TOEFL if you have not done so earlier.

8. Key Timeline: Second Semester of Senior Year (Feb – Jul) | 重要时间节点:高三下学期(2月–7月)

February – March: Wait for initial screening results. Qualified applicants will receive invitations to Campus Day, typically held between March and April. Prepare thoroughly for the Campus Day, practising English discussion and critical thinking. April – May: Pre-admission results are released. Accept the offer by the specified deadline. June: Take the Gaokao wholeheartedly. After the Gaokao, submit your final scores if required. Late June – July: Gaokao scores are announced. The universities complete the final admission procedure. For those on the Gaokao-only track, fill in the college application form during this period. Successful candidates receive their admission letters by late July.

9. Interview and Campus Day Preparation | 面试与校园日准备

Campus Day is the core of comprehensive evaluation. It often includes a timed English writing task, group discussion, and a one-on-one interview with admission officers. The key to success is demonstrating logical thinking, cross-cultural awareness, and genuine intellectual curiosity, not memorised answers. Practise mock interviews with a teacher or friend, read English news articles to build content knowledge, and work on expressing opinions concisely. During group discussions, take care to listen actively and build on others’ ideas.

10. Scholarships and Financial Considerations | 奖学金与财务考虑

Tuition fees at Sino-foreign cooperative universities generally range from 100,000 to 170,000 RMB per year. To support outstanding students, most institutions offer merit-based scholarships covering full or partial tuition. For instance, Duke Kunshan and NYU Shanghai award automatic scholarship consideration during the admission process, based on comprehensive evaluation performance and Gaokao results. There are also need-based financial aid options. Plan your family finances early and check each university’s scholarship policies, as some require a separate application or have specific deadlines.

11. Common Misconceptions and Tips | 常见误区与注意事项

Myth 1: These universities are easy to get into because they are not traditional Chinese top-tier schools. Reality: Competition is fierce, with acceptance rates often below 10%. Myth 2: Strong English alone guarantees admission. Reality: Holistic review looks at academic consistency, thinking skills, and personal qualities, not just language. Myth 3: Campus Day is just a formality. Reality: It can dramatically change your ranking. The most common mistake is missing the application window – mark all deadlines on a calendar. Another key tip is to maintain a balanced profile: participate in extracurricular activities, community service, or subject competitions, as these will enrich your personal statement.
